I am looking for some advice regarding the rebuilding of a 200TDI 110 Land Rover Defender engine.  I am currently living in Egypt with my 1993 vehicle.  It has had a major breakdown and intial diagnosis indicates that the engine will require rebuilding as one of the cylinders has broken.
It is difficult here to find both the parts required and an honest, reliable mechanic to rebuild the engine and I am desperately seeking some advice regarding the following:
- Approximate cost of 4 new pistons and related gaskets and seals in the uk and a new oil pump.
- Likely cost and time involved in transporting these parts to Cairo.
- An estimate of how much time it should take an experienced mechanic to carry out the work and how much this work would cost if carried out by a suitably qualified mechanic in the UK.
I would also really value your advice as to whether this work is something which is worth undertaking on a vehicle of this age (170,000 miles), bearing in mind that I have already replaced the gear box, clutch & radiator and invested a lot of money previously   kitting it out as a fully equipped safari vehicle.  In light of this I would really like to hold onto the car as it is the perfect vehicle for this country (superb offroading opportunities) and it would be extremely difficult to replace.

Best bet for the parts would be http://www.paddockspares.com they'll ship Worldwide.

If it were my car, I'd rebuild the engine - failing that I'd at least replace it with another Tdi, bearing in mind they're relatively easy to lay ones hands on in the UK as there's a lot of rusty Disco 1's out there with perfectly serviceable Tdi's in them.

Don't know how long a rebuild would likely take I'm afraid, never had to do one on a Tdi.
